			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This makes a wicked combonation, the recipe uses quite a lot of chilli, i say its meduium hot but others will think its hot, if you are unsure, add a little at a time, give it a good mix then taste it and adjust if its not hot enough.</p>
<p>ngredients<br />
200g/7¼oz unsalted butter<br />
200g/7¼oz demerara sugar<br />
200g/7¼oz honey<br />
400g/14¼oz porridge oats<br />
100g chocolate broken into pieces.<br />
combination of chillis&#8230;..use what you are comfortable with but i like&#8230;1 fresh chilli finely sliced, 1 teaspoon of dried chilli and 1 teaspoon of chilli powder. (you can also add coconut, ginger, cherries and any other bits of fruit/nut you like )</p>
<p>You will also need a 20cm x 30cm (8in x 12in) cake tin, greased</p>
<p>Method</p>
<p>1. Put the butter, sugar and honey in a saucepan and heat, stirring occasionally, until the butter has melted and the sugar has dissolved. Add the chilli,chocolate and oats  and mix well.</p>
<p>2. Transfer the oat mixture to the prepared cake tin and spread to about 2cm (¾in) thick. Smooth the surface withthe back of a spoon. Bake in a preheated oven at 180C/350F/Gas 4 for 15-20 minutes, until lightly golden around the edges, but still slightly soft in the middle.</p>
<p>3.Let cool in the tin, then turn out and cut into squares.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This is an adaptation of a recipe in the green and blacks chocolate cook book.</p>
<p>it takes a while for the chillis to marinade so its best to do them well in advance</p>
<p>Ingredients:</p>
<p>6 green chillis</p>
<p>6 red chillis</p>
<p>350ml vodka</p>
<p>100g of good quality chocolate (use your favourite white dark or milk)</p>
<p>black pepper</p>
<p>100g of dark good quality dark chocolate</p>
<p>icing sugar</p>
<p>method</p>
<p>wash the chillis, the cut a tiny slit in the side of them, remove the seeds and white membrane then soak in vodka for at least 12 hours.</p>
<p>once marinated you can continue with the bits below</p>
<p>melt the 100g of your favourite choc and mix in a shot of vodka and a pinch of pepper.</p>
<p>transfer to a piping bag and pipe the mix into your chillis</p>
<p>then freeze until needed</p>
<p><strong>to serve</strong></p>
<p>Sprinkle a plate with icing sugar and a little more pepper</p>
<p>melt the 100g of dark chocolate and dip the chillis in &#8230;.leaving 1/3  of the chilli not covered in choc</p>
<p>place on the plate then serve</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I&#8217;ve been waiting for the results of the Walkers do us a flavour competition for a while now as i was intrigued to see if it would include and new or exciting crisp flavours as its about time we had some new and interesting flavours.</p>
<p>Well ive not been dissapointed with the 6 winning flavours being:</p>
<ul>
<li>Chilli and Chocolate</li>
<li>Builders Breakfast</li>
<li>Onion Bajji</li>
<li>Fish and Chips</li>
<li>Cajun Squirrel</li>
<li>Duck and hoy sin sauce.</li>
</ul>
<p>Id heard rumours they were being released today in Asda so called in on the way home, i manged to get all the flavours apart from Cajun Squirrel which i got from Asda near work!</p>
